What are inHumans? How do they differ from the myriad of other magical beings​ in the Marvel Universe.

Basically they have their own isolated society ruled by a royal family. Whenever a kid comes of age they get exposed to a substance called terrigen which essentially mutates them randomly, thanks to genetic experimentation by ancient aliens. What makes them different from the X-Men is the fact that they have their own weird society and a lot of family/royal drama, and there's usually a lot less emphasis on being accepted by the masses. It's less of "I just want to go to school and be a normal kid" and more of "is our society/nation even going to have dealings with the rest of the planet".

This has changed slightly in the MCU, with Inhumans starting to show up in the normal population like mutants, because Marvel doesn't have movie rights to the actual X-Men.
